Cartoon characters often end up on a precipice, the edge of a steep cliff, where their chubby toes curl and cling as they totter and eventually fall, making a hole in the ground below and getting up again. If you look at usage of “precipitous” (which stems from precipice) it can be used in reference to both sharp increases or sharp decreases; a common turn of phrase might be a “to have a precipitous rise through the ranks” which does not carry a negative connotation.
